UPC 691957140835, Leki Quantum Ski Pole, Black/Red, 120cm

UPC 691957140835

Leki Quantum Ski Pole, Black/Red, 120cm

Product Details
Product Category Sports
Product Type Outdoor Recreation Product
Brand Leki
Manufacturer Leki
Color Black/Red
Binding Sports
Label Leki
Model 6374638- 120
Publisher Leki
Size 120cm
Studio Leki
Country USA & Canada
Last Updated January 20, 2018 13

More Products